I would like to hear PB members views on the following. We had 11 old bird races starting on Saturday 20th April 2013 and had our last old bird race on Sunday 30th June. Our Young Bird programme has 9 races with our first race on Saturday 13th July from Brechin and due to us having such a short time between our OB & YB races it does not give our members much time to train their young birds after the old birds have finished. During our first 2 young bird races we have English old bird racing still going on from Fraserburgh & Thurso and also some of our members are still competing in the SNFC. IN MY OPINION next year we should start old bird racing one week later on Saturday 26th April and revert back to 7 young bird races starting on Saturday 26th July as this would give the members extra time for training and also help the race controller concentrate on the young birds instead of having to worry about the English Feds. above us. If we have only one young bird race from Brechin next year on the 26th July we would get about 2500 birds and just have the lorry going down once instead of 3 times which will happen this year. It looks like the first 2 young bird races this year are not going to be well supported as there was only 1150 birds at the first race and we will be lucky if we get 750 birds this week. Thank You George Duthie
